297+ Using Enums as Workflow Places
298+ ~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
299+
300+ When using a state machine, you can use PHP backend enums as places in your workflows:
301+
302+ .. versionadded :: 7.4
303+
304+ The support for PHP backed enums as workflow places was introduced with Symfony 7.4.
305+
306+ First, define your enum with backed values::
307+
308+ // src/Enumeration/BlogPostStatus.php
309+ namespace App\Enumeration;
310+
311+ enum BlogPostStatus: string
312+ {
313+ case Draft = 'draft';
314+ case Reviewed = 'reviewed';
315+ case Published = 'published';
316+ case Rejected = 'rejected';
317+ }
